Arsenal have had a new bid thrown out by Celtic for Kieran Tierney and if reports from Football Scotland are to be believed, the London club have insulted the Scottish Champions by only upping their original offer by £2.5m taking the bid to £17.5 plus addons.

If this is the case then Celtic should point blank refuse to talk to Arsenal until they meet the player’s valuation.

Neil Lennon confirmed this week the London club are interested and more importantly they know exactly how much Celtic want for the player. Despite that knowledge they have decided to low ball Celtic for a second time.

If we didn’t know any better I would think Peter Lawwell works for Arsenal as well.

Kieran Tierney is Celtic’s star player and won’t be leaving for a derisory bid this summer. The defender is a Celtic fan and on a long term deal.

If Arsenal want him, it’s simple, pay the price.
